How Artificial Intelligence Is Transforming Games

One of the most noticeable uses of AI in games is intelligent non-player characters. These characters can respond to player movements, change their strategies, and behave differently depending on what happens during gameplay. This can make game worlds feel more active and unpredictable.

AI can also be used to create challenging opponents. Instead of following simple patterns, intelligent opponents can adapt to different playing styles. A player who repeatedly uses the same strategy may eventually encounter enemies that recognize and respond to that behavior.

Procedural content generation is another area where AI can contribute to gaming. Developers can use intelligent systems to help create maps, environments, missions, objects, and other elements. This approach can increase variety while reducing the amount of repetitive work involved in producing large game worlds.

Personalization is also becoming more important. AI systems can potentially adjust difficulty, challenges, recommendations, and gameplay elements according to individual players. This could make games more accessible to beginners while still providing challenging experiences for experienced players.

AI can also support game developers during the development process. Intelligent tools may assist with testing, animation, dialogue generation, level design, debugging, and other production tasks. These technologies do not necessarily replace creative developers; instead, they can provide additional tools for speeding up certain parts of development.

Storytelling is another area that may benefit from AI. Interactive characters could respond to players in more flexible ways, creating conversations that feel less predictable. Future games may allow story elements to change based on individual decisions and playing styles.

AI-powered games can also create more dynamic worlds. Weather, enemy behavior, quests, and environmental events may be adjusted according to what players do. Such systems can make repeated playthroughs feel different and encourage players to explore alternative strategies.

However, developing AI games also presents challenges. Developers must balance intelligent behavior with fairness and enjoyable gameplay. An opponent that is too powerful or unpredictable may frustrate players rather than entertain them.

Another important consideration is the role of human creativity. Games depend on storytelling, artistic direction, design, music, and emotional experiences. AI can assist with many technical tasks, but successful games still require thoughtful creative decisions.
